Achievements
Since inception in 2007, the programme continues to grow and move from strength-to-strength:
- Summer 2007: 1st phase pilot with Pathways to Professions and independent schools, enabling 20 students to take part in a week-long programme at the Western General
- Summer 2008: 2nd phase pilot opened up structured application route, and worked in close collaboration with the Pathways team to place 40 students
